ELEC / SYSTEM

The Industrial Electrical System

Electrical components perform different functions along the path between incoming power and the final machine load. Selection depends on voltage, current, phase, frequency, circuit type, environment, control requirements, and physical interfaces.

ELEC / 01

Transform Power

Transformers change voltage levels or provide electrical isolation for machinery, controls, distribution, and specialized loads.

ELEC / 02

Convert Power

Power supplies convert incoming electrical energy into the voltage and current form required by controls, electronics, sensors, and equipment.

ELEC / 03

Connect Circuits

Connectors, plugs, cordsets, terminals, and cables create removable or permanent electrical interfaces between components.

ELEC / 04

Switch + Command

Switches and operator interfaces provide manual or electrical control over machine functions and circuit states.

ELEC / 05

Create Motion

Electric motors convert electrical power into mechanical torque and rotation for industrial machinery and motion systems.

ELEC / 06

Protect the System

Enclosures, shielding, grounding, insulation, and protective devices help isolate electrical equipment from people and environmental conditions.

ELEC / POWER PATH

Trace power from the source to the load.

Industrial electrical selection becomes clearer when the system is treated as a sequence of power conversion, distribution, connection, control, and use.

Each interface must carry the required electrical load while remaining compatible with the equipment around it.

OT / INDUSTRIAL ELECTRICAL PATH
Source
Facility service, generator, battery system, or other source provides incoming electrical energy.
Transform
Transformers adjust voltage levels, isolation, or distribution characteristics where required.
Convert
Power supplies and electronic equipment convert incoming power into forms required by lower-voltage controls and electronics.
Distribute
Conductors, panels, enclosures, cables, and circuit hardware route power to equipment.
Connect
Connectors, plugs, receptacles, terminals, and cordsets create interfaces between equipment and wiring.
Control
Switches, drives, relays, sensors, controllers, and operator interfaces determine when and how loads operate.
Load
Motors, heaters, solenoids, electronics, lighting, and production equipment consume the delivered electrical power.

ELEC / SPEC

Electrical Specifications to Define

Electrical components should be compared against the complete circuit and application rather than against one nominal rating.

Factor
Questions
Related Components
Voltage
What nominal, maximum, transient, input, and output voltages must the system handle?
Transformers, power supplies, connectors, cords, switches
Current
What continuous, starting, peak, or fault current must the component safely carry?
Conductors, connectors, switches, motors, power supplies
Phase
Does the equipment require single-phase, three-phase, DC, or another electrical configuration?
Transformers, motors, power equipment
Frequency
What supply frequency or operating frequency is required by the electrical equipment?
Motors, transformers, power conversion equipment
Interface
What plug, connector, terminal, wire size, pinout, grounding, mounting, or enclosure interface is required?
Connectors, cords, plugs, switches, enclosures
Environment
Will the equipment experience heat, moisture, dust, chemicals, vibration, washdown, outdoor exposure, or electromagnetic interference?
Enclosures, cords, connectors, motors, switches, shielding
Control
How will the device be switched, monitored, commanded, protected, or integrated with machine controls?
Switches, sensors, drives, power supplies, connectors
